The Functions of Eggs in Cheesecakes

Eggs perform several critical functions in cheesecakes, making them an indispensable ingredient. These functions can be broadly categorized into leavening, moisture, richness, and structure.

Leavening

Eggs, particularly the egg whites, contain air pockets that expand during baking, contributing to the cheesecake’s rise. This leavening effect is crucial for achieving the desired height and lightness in cheesecakes. The inclusion of eggs ensures that the cheesecake does not end up dense and flat, which would compromose its appeal and texture.

Moisture

Eggs add moisture to the cheesecake batter, which is essential for maintaining the dessert’s freshness and preventing it from drying out. The moisture content also affects the cheesecake’s texture, with the right amount ensuring a smooth, creamy dessert. Overbaking or using too few eggs can lead to a dry, crumbly cheesecake that lacks appeal.

Richness

The yolks of the eggs contribute richness and depth to the cheesecake. The fats and proteins in the yolks enhance the flavor profile of the cheesecake, making it more complex and satisfying. This richness is a key component of what makes cheesecakes indulgent and desirable.

Structure

Perhaps the most critical role of eggs in cheesecakes is in providing structure. The proteins in the eggs coagulate during baking, setting the cheesecake and giving it its shape. This structural integrity is vital for the cheesecake to hold its form after it has been removed from the oven and cooled. Without eggs, cheesecakes would lack the firmness and stability that defines them.

The Science Behind Eggs in Cheesecakes

Understanding the science behind how eggs function in cheesecakes can help bakers optimize their recipes and techniques. The process of baking a cheesecake involves a series of chemical reactions and physical changes, with eggs at the center of many of these transformations.

Cooking and Coagulation

When a cheesecake is baked, the heat causes the proteins in the eggs to denature and coagulate. This process gives the cheesecake its structure and texture. The coagulation of proteins, along with the gelation of starches in the crust and the setting of the cheese, are critical for the cheesecake to hold its shape and have the right consistency.

Emulsification

Eggs also play a role in emulsification, the process of combining two or more liquids that wouldn’t normally mix, like oil and water. In cheesecakes, eggs help to emulsify the cheese, cream, and other liquid ingredients, creating a smooth, consistent batter. This emulsification is essential for the cheesecake to have a uniform texture and to prevent separation during baking.

Tips for Using Eggs Effectively in Cheesecakes

To get the most out of eggs in your cheesecakes, consider the following tips:

  • Room Temperature Eggs: Using eggs at room temperature incorporates air more efficiently and ensures that the ingredients mix smoothly and evenly.
  • Gentle Mixing: Overmixing can incorporate too much air and lead to a cheesecake that cracks or sinks. Mix your ingredients just until they come together in a smooth batter.
  • Don’t Overbake: Overbaking can cause the eggs to over-coagulate, leading to a dry, cracked cheesecake. Monitor your cheesecake closely towards the end of the baking time.
  • Egg Quality: Fresh eggs will have better emulsification properties and contribute to a lighter, fluffier texture in your cheesecakes.

Common Issues and Solutions

Despite the best intentions, issues can arise when baking cheesecakes. Cracks, sinking, and uneven baking are common problems that can often be traced back to the eggs or the baking process.

Cracking

Cracking in cheesecakes is often due to overbaking or sudden changes in temperature, causing the eggs to contract and the cheesecake to crack. To prevent cracking, ensure your cheesecake cools slowly and evenly. A water bath can help maintain a consistent temperature during baking.

Sinking

Sinking can occur if the eggs do not provide enough structure or if the cheesecake is removed from the oven too soon. Ensuring that the cheesecake is fully set and using the right number of eggs for the recipe can help prevent sinking.

What is the ideal egg-to-cream cheese ratio in cheesecakes?

The ideal egg-to-cream cheese ratio in cheesecakes can vary depending on the recipe and the desired texture and flavor. Generally, a ratio of 2-3 large eggs per 16 ounces of cream cheese is a good starting point. This ratio provides enough eggs to bind the ingredients together, add moisture, and create a creamy texture, without overpowering the flavor of the cream cheese. However, some recipes may call for more or fewer eggs, depending on the addition of other ingredients, such as sour cream, buttermilk, or flavorings.

It’s also important to consider the type of cream cheese used, as this can impact the egg-to-cream cheese ratio. For example, a higher-fat cream cheese may require fewer eggs, while a lower-fat cream cheese may require more. Additionally, the texture and flavor of the cheesecake can be adjusted by changing the egg-to-cream cheese ratio. For example, a higher egg ratio can create a lighter, fluffier cheesecake, while a lower egg ratio can result in a denser, creamier cheesecake. By experimenting with different ratios and ingredients, bakers can find the perfect balance for their desired cheesecake texture and flavor.
